WebAug 7, 2012 · Remember that C# is case-sensitive. Instead of Dataset, you need to write it as DataSet. Also, be careful with Datarow, which should be DataRow. Of course, for this to work you also need a "using System.Data" directive at the beginning of your source code. Please verify that the directive is there, and add it if it is not.
